Vanguard S&P 500 ETF $VOO is Stephens Greth Foundation’s Largest Position

Stephens Greth Foundation grew its holdings in Vanguard S&P 500 ETF (NYSEARCA:VOOFree Report) by 52.5% in the 1st qu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 374,237 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 128,836 shares during the quarter. Vanguard S&P 500 ETF comprises 69.9% of Stephens Greth Foundation’s investment portfolio, making the stock its biggest holding. Stephens Greth Foundation’s holdings in Vanguard S&P 500 ETF were worth $223,625,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

About Vanguard S&P 500 ETF

Vanguard 500 Index Fund (the Fund) is an open-end investment company, or mutual fund. The Fund offers four classes of shares: Investor Shares, Admiral Shares, Signal Shares, and Exchange Traded Fund (ETF) Shares. The Fund seeks to track the investment performance of the Standard & Poor’s 500 Index, an unmanaged benchmark representing the United States large-capitalization stocks. The Fund employs a passive management-or indexing-investment approach designed to track the performance of the Standard & Poor’s 500 Index.
